Abstract
In this work we give a formalization of Hybrid Functional Petri Nets, shortly HFPN, an extension of Petri Nets for biopathways modelling, and we compare them with Metabolic P Systems. An introduction to both the formalisms is given, together with highlights about respective similarities and differences. Their equivalence is thus proved by means of a theorem which holds under quite general hypotheses. The case study of the lac operon gene regulatory mechanism in the glycolytic pathway of Escherichia coli is modeled by an MP system which provides the same dynamics of an equivalent HFPN model.
Access this article
We’re sorry, something doesn't seem to be working properly.
Please try refreshing the page. If that doesn't work, please contact support so we can address the problem.









Similar content being viewed by others
Explore related subjects
Discover the latest articles, news and stories from top researchers in related subjects.Notes
The Cell Illustrator™ Project website Url: http://www.genomicobject.net.
Enlarged images Url: http://mplab.sci.univr.it/external/ncj_hfpn_as_mps/images.html.
The MetaPlab website Url: http://mplab.sci.univr.it.
References
Alberts B, Johnson A, Lewis J, Raff M, Roberts K, Walter P (2002) Molecular biology of the cell. Garland Science, New York
Bianco L, Castellini A (2007) Psim: a computational platform for Metabolic P systems. In: LNCS 4860, Springer, Berlin, pp 1–20
Bianco L, Fontana F, Franco G, Manca V (2006a) P systems for biological dynamics. In: Ciobanu et al (eds) Applications of membrane computing. Natural computing series. Springer, Berlin, pp 81–126
Bianco L, Fontana F, Manca V (2006b) P systems with reaction maps. Int J Found Comput Sci 17(1):27–48
Castellini A, Manca V (2009) MetaPlab: a computational framework for metabolic P systems. In: LNCS 5391, Springer-Verlag, pp 157–168
Castellini A, Franco G, Manca V (2009) Toward a representation of Hybrid Functional Petri Nets by MP systems. In: Suzuki Y et al (eds) Natural Computing PICT 1, pp 28–37
Ciobanu G, Păun G, Pérez-Jiménez MJ (eds) (2006) Applications of membrane computing. Natural computing series. Springer, New York
Doi A, Fujita S, Matsuno H, Nagasaki M, Miyano S (2004) Constructing biological pathway models with Hybrid Functional Petri Nets. In Silico Biol 4(3):271–291
Fontana F, Manca V (2007) Discrete solutions to differential equations by Metabolic P systems. Theor Comput Sci 372(2–3):165–182
Fontana F, Manca V (2008) Predator–prey dynamics in P systems ruled by metabolic algorithm. BioSystems 91(3):545–557
Hofestädt R (1994) A Petri Net application to model metabolic processes. J Syst Anal Model Simulation 16(2):113–122
Hofestädt R, Thelen S (1998) Quantitative modeling of biochemical networks. In Silico Biol 1:39–53
Manca V (2006) MP systems approaches to biochemical dynamics: biological rhythms and oscillations. In: LNCS 4361, Springer, New York, pp 86–99
Manca V (2008a) Discrete simulations of biochemical dynamics. In: LNCS 4848, Springer, pp 231–235
Manca V (2008b) The metabolic algorithm: principles and applications. Theor Comput Sci 404:142–157
Manca V, Bianco L (2008) Biological networks in metabolic P systems. BioSystems 91(3):489–498
Manca V, Bianco L, Fontana F (2005) Evolutions and oscillations of P systems: applications to biochemical phenomena. In: LNCS 3365, Springer, pp 63–84
Matsuno H, Tanaka Y, Aoshima H, Doi A, Matsui M, Miyano S (2003) Biopathways representation and simulation on Hybrid Functional Petri Nets. In Silico Biol 3(3):389–404
Nagasaki M, Doi A, Matsuno H, Miyano S (2004) Genomic object net: I. A platform for modelling and simulating biopathways. Appl Bioinformatics 2(3):181–184
Petri CA (1962) Kommunikation mit automaten. Bonn: Institut fur Instrumentelle Mathematik, Schriften des IIM Nr. 2, German
Păun G (2000) Computing with membranes. J Comput Syst Sci 61(1):108–143
Păun G (2002) Membrane computing: an introduction. Springer, Berlin
Reddy VN, Mavrovouniotis ML, Liebman MN (1993) Petri Net representations in metabolic pathways. In: Shavlik JW, Hunter L, Searls DB (eds) Proceedings of the 1st International Conference on Intelligent Systems for Molecular Biology, AAAI Press, pp 328–336
Reisig W (1985) Petri Nets: an introduction. EATCS, Monographs on Theoretical Computer Science. Springer, New York
Author information
Authors and Affiliations
Corresponding author
Rights and permissions
About this article
Cite this article
Castellini, A., Franco, G. & Manca, V. Hybrid Functional Petri Nets as MP systems. Nat Comput 9, 61–81 (2010). https://doi.org/10.1007/s11047-009-9121-4
Received: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s11047-009-9121-4